Fortunately all of your opening dates are pretty close together so you're not stuck with a lackluster card that you can't close for the sole reason of being your oldest card.  In 10 years a few months won't make that much of a difference in account age.

 

As for the Delta, your SkyMiles are stored in your SkyMiles account not with Amex and they never expire.  You never want to close a Membership Rewards earning card with points on it unless you have another MR earning card, but with cobranded cards like Delta and Starwood you're fine.  If you want SkyMiles no sense in closing that one, and you can always transfer Membership Rewards to SkyMiles with at least a 1:1 ratio.  If you don't shop at JCP or Best Buy, certainly those could go.  If you don't shop at Kohl's, certainly that one as well - but if you do shop there, don't be disheartened by the low credit limit.  Almost everyone starts at $300, then goes to $700, $1500 and $3000 in 3-6 month increments.

 

As for the rest of the cards, we'd really need to know what you spend money on and whether you prefer cash back or travel rewards to make suggestions.  Also keep in mind that while it's at 0%, your Discover looks maxed out to lenders and will certainly ding your scores.
